Walmart Marketplace Retailer Agreement

The Comprehensive Walmart Marketplace Retailer Agreement (the "Agreement") outlines the terms and conditions applicable to all sellers who take part in the WFS program. The Agreement contains the Standard Terms and Conditions for the Walmart Marketplace Program; Walmart Fulfillment Services Terms and Conditions; and Walmart Ad Center Terms and Conditions.

The Agreement has been updated effective August 12, 2024. Your continued use of Walmart Fulfillment Services after July 25, 2022 constitutes your acceptance of the updated agreement. We'll notify sellers of any changes to the Agreement or to WFS fees.

WFS Inbound Logistics Services/Preferred Carrier Program

WFS offers access to preferred carrier rates for shipments from locations within the 48 contiguous United States to a WFS fulfillment center with inbound logistics services capability. The Walmart Preferred Carrier Program provides inbound service for small parcel, less-than truckload (LTL) and full truckload (FTL).

About Walmart.com

Walmart Inc. (NYSE:WMT) helps people around the world save money and live better- anytime and anywhere - in retail stores, online, and through their mobile devices. Each week, approximately 240 million customers and members visit more than 10,500 stores and numerous eCommerce websites in 20 countries. With fiscal year 2023 revenue of $611 billion, Walmart employs approximately 2.1 million associates worldwide. Walmart continues to be a leader in sustainability, corporate philanthropy and employment opportunity.
